The literal space that a HDD can use to store information effects nothing, you don't even need a 500gb HDD. You need to look at the RPM's it has, or better yet, get an SSD. (7200prm or better, never less.) and even THEN these specifications only effect the launch speed of the program, not actual fps. Next, you abso-fucking-lutely do not need 10gb of RAM. You won't even find a laptop with 10gb, it is just such an uncommon number. You'll be safe easily with 6gb, maybe even 4gb. Just don't play more than two games at once and you are a-okay. Third, graphics cards aren't necessarily measured by the gigabytes. You could have a 1gb GPU out perform a 2gb GPU. While it does effect performance, it certainly is not a number you should really take into consideration. You want to look at the graphics clock, and the texture fill rate. (this is going to take some research by typing in the gpu the computer your looking at buying is using.) For example, a clock speed of 700 with a texture fill rate of 11+ is going to give you pretty steady fps on most games, at low-medium settings. You'll have trouble on high. Obviously, this is pretty bare-minimum (for me, atleast) so any increase in these numbers will do you wonders. Fourth, you can't "rate" a processor good or bad by simply stating that it is dual core or quad core. Get a processor of 2.4ghz+ and you'll be safe. From all of the above, you'll be able to play all games. Increase these numbers slightly and your fps will increase. When looking at gaming pc's specifically, you always look for the one with the better GPU, then CPU, then RAM, in order from most important to least important as far as fps.
